Subject: Arrival arrangements — Fennor Labs summer interns

Dear team assistants,

Our cohort of twelve interns arrives Monday at the Quillbrook Plaza lobby at 09:00. Please ensure each intern's desk assignment is confirmed in advance and that welcome folders are placed out on Friday evening. Reception will handle sign-in, but an assistant must be present to escort the group upstairs, as the lifts are badge-controlled. Permanent badges will be issued Tuesday; until then, escorts should use the temporary lift code provided below.

door code, tagef-bajop: bdg-SB-7

MEMO TO: Heads of Department
FROM: Operations, Brindlecote Fabrics Ltd
RE: Annual insurance renewal

Our property and liability cover with Marleth Underwriting expires at the end of next month. Premiums are up roughly nine percent, reflecting last year's warehouse claim in Dunsall. We intend to renew on broadly current terms while seeking a higher deductible on stock cover. Please confirm any changes to declared equipment values by Friday. The renewal decision connects to wider considerations, noted confidentially below.

confidential, yahip-hagug: Gorixax Logistics plans to lower the Ulaael list price by 26.6 percent in October. The pricing group signed off on a budget of $199.9 million for Project Holix. The renewal with Kasdorox Systems closes at $137.5 million a year, 8.2 percent above the last contract. Project Lamion slips by a full year because of the audit delay.

Ticket #4471 — Vault locked: InvoiceForge PDF renderer

The signing vault for the InvoiceForge PDF invoice renderer locked itself after three failed attempts during last night's deploy. Renders are queued but unsigned. Security review needed before we reopen it. Per the Brindlewood recovery procedure, unlocking requires the passphrase recorded below.

unlock words, bahop-fawef: novmir-druwyn-soriel-rusdor-kasion

### Onboarding: Cron Drift Investigation (Tickly)

Context for reviewers: Tickly schedulers drifted ~40s/day across the Fenwood cluster. Fix under review pins jobs to the NTP-synced leader. Check the drift-compensation math and the leader-election fallback. Repro scripts live in the drift-lab repo. To run the lab's sealed fixtures, unlock them with the recovery passphrase below.

strongbox words: sorir-belvan-rusix-ulays-ralmir-praix-eliir-tamax-praael-druael-julir-tamius-jorir